Vineyard sprayer's lung is seen in which metal poisoning

A
Arsenic
B
Mercury
C
Lead
D
Copper
High-Yield Explanation
Vineyard sprayer's lung: Persons engaged in spraying copper sulphate in vineyards due to chronic inhalation of copper sulphate show features of granulomatous lung and liver damage. Ref: FORENSIC MEDICINE AND TOXICOLOGY Dr PC IGNATIUS THIRD EDITION PAGE 430
